# Send multiple transactions Send multiple times. Amounts are decimal numbers with at most 8 digits of precision. Change generated from a taddr flows to a new taddr address, while change generated from a zaddr returns to itself. When sending coinbase UTXOs to a zaddr, change is not allowed. The entire value of the UTXO(s) must be consumed. Before Acadia (Sapling) activates, the maximum number of zaddr outputs is 54 due to transaction size limits. Endpoint: POST /daemon/zsendmany Version: 6.6.1 Security: ZelID ## Request fields (text/plain): - `fromaddress` (string) The taddr or zaddr to send the funds from - `amounts` (array) An array of json objects representing the amounts to send - `amounts.address` (string) The taddr or zaddr to send the funds from - `amounts.amount` (number) The numeric amount in FLUX is the value - `amounts.memo` (string) If the address is a zaddr, raw data represented in hexadecimal string format. (optional) - `minconf` (integer) Only use funds confirmed at least this many times (optional) - `fee` (number) The fee amount to attach to this transaction (optional) ## Response 200 fields (application/json): - `status` (string) Explanation of status Enum: "success", "error" - `data` (string) Operation id